The Book: Ghosts by Dolly Alderton

Funny, tender and eminently, movingly relatable, Ghosts is a whip-smart tale of relationships and modern life.” – Penguin Random House

This is a romantic comedy about writer Nina Dean who is single and living her best life in London, England. Then while online dating, she meets Max, a good-looking Accountant and they seem to be having a great time together until he ghosts her. In addition to the boy drama, Nina has family drama and work drama to contend with – her dad’s worsening Alzheimer’s and her mother’s denial of the situation and a new book that’s not making her boss happy. Nina has a lot going on in her life. Will she be alright?
